Senior platform engineer building and operating Virtasant’s production Kubernetes infrastructure. Owning cloud reliability, observability, migrations, and developer delivery platforms across remote Americas teams.
Responsibilities
Design, build, and operate production Kubernetes clusters, including networking, workload isolation, and multi-region topologies
Work with Kubernetes internals, resource quotas, scheduling, NetworkPolicy enforcement, and custom controllers or operators
Implement and operate service mesh capabilities, including mTLS, workload authentication and authorization, and traffic management
Optimize containerized workloads for performance, cost, and resource efficiency
Write, refactor, and maintain production Go, Python, or Java services, controllers, and middleware
Build HTTP, REST, and gRPC interfaces for internal engineering teams
Write unit and integration tests
Lead incident response, investigate root causes, and author postmortems
Troubleshoot production systems using logs, metrics, traces, and profiling tools
Define and drive SLOs and actionable alerting
Own infrastructure as code and maintain reusable modules
Build and improve CI/CD and GitOps delivery workflows
Plan and execute cloud migration initiatives while maintaining reliability and minimizing downtime
Build and maintain metrics, dashboards, alerting policies, and distributed tracing
Partner with product, security, and infrastructure teams on requirements and architecture
Contribute to design reviews, set technical direction, and mentor engineers
